    • PROBLEM TO BE SOLVED: To provide a thermosetting powder coating material having sufficient low temperature curing property while produced in a wet producing process, imparting a coating film having a high crosslinking density and appearance in high level even baking and crosslinking at a comparatively low temperature while sufficiently inhibiting yellowing and foaming, applicable to a dense chromatic color together with a pale chromatic color.
      SOLUTION: The invention relates to the thermosetting powder coating material obtained by the following processes, preparing a suspension liquid by dispersing a resin solution containing organic solvents in an aqueous solution containing a water soluble polymer, a process solidifying particles in the dispersing phase by evaporating the organic solvents in the dispersing phase in the suspension and then a process separating the particles in the solidified dispersing phase, wherein the resin solution comprises an acrylic resin having an epoxy group and a blocked isocyanate group, and a compound containing a carboxylic acid group or carboxylic acid anhydride group as a hardener.

    • PROBLEM TO BE SOLVED: To provide a means for forming a clear layer having a good coating film appearance by suppressing the occurrence of spitting by a method of carrying out an electrostatic coating of a powder coating material F on the car body to form the clear layer.
      SOLUTION: The method is characterized in that a fine particulate powder coating material having an average particle diameter of 10-15 μm is used as a powder coating material F, a flow of sending air which is a total of a flow of suction air and a flow of dilution air becomes fixed, each flow of the suction air and the dilution air is controlled such that the supply of the powder coating material F to a coating gun 5 becomes to be a set amount, and as coating gun 5, a coating gun in which the outer peripheral portion is covered by a porous casing, and an adhesion prevention air flows through an outer peripheral passage provided inside the porous casing to jet from an adhesion prevention air jet hole, and at the same time, via the porous casing also from the outer peripheral portion of the coating gun, is used.

    • PROBLEM TO BE SOLVED: To provide a method for covering an iron base material with a powder coating film, in which the powder coating film can be baked at low temperature and the powder coating film excellent in secondary physical properties such as water resistance, light resistance and heat resistance can be obtained.
      SOLUTION: The method for covering the iron base material has: a process A for forming a chemically treated layer by treating a surface of the iron base material with a chemical treatment agent which contains (a) at least one kind selected from among zirconium, titanium and hafnium, (b) fluorine and (c) an amino functional compound; a process B for applying, onto the chemically treated layer, a powder coating material composition which contains a polyester resin with an acid value of 23 to 90 mgKOH/g and a β-hydroxyalkyl amide curing agent expressed by general formula I (wherein R
      1 denotes a hydrogen atom, a methyl group or an ethyl group, R
      2 denotes a hydrogen atom, a 1-5C alkyl group or HO-CH(R
      1 )-CH
      2 - and A denotes a bivalent hydrocarbon group); and a process C for curing the powder coating material composition by baking.

    • PROBLEM TO BE SOLVED: To provide a powder coating composition which provides a coating film excellent particularly in machinability in the field of aluminum wheel coating while maintaining usual coating film physical properties, can provide an excellent coating film even when it is applied to a substrate after non-chromate treatment, and can be suitably used, for example, as a primer powder coating material for aluminum wheels.
      SOLUTION: The powder coating composition comprises powder coating particles made of a polyester resin (i) which comprises 70 mol% or more of terephthalic acid and isophthalic acid based on the total acid component composing the polyester resin and has a resin solid acid number of 10-100 mg KOH/g-solid, and an epoxy resin (ii) having an epoxy equivalent of 100-4,000 mg KOH/g-solid. The powder coating particles further comprises a flexible resin (iii), and the above (iii) is 1-12 mass% based on 100 mass% of the sum of the solids of the above (i) and the above (ii) and has a number average molecular weight of 30,000-100,000.
